The Influence of North African Cuisine North African cuisine encompasses a mouthwatering variety of flavors and culinary traditions, with influences from countries such as Morocco, Algeria, Tunisia, and Egypt. These cuisines are characterized by their bold spices, aromatic herbs, and diverse range of ingredients such as couscous, lamb, chickpeas, and dried fruits. The combination of these elements results in a perfect blend of sweet, savory, and spicy flavors that tantalize the taste buds.
